Career Roles in Creative Nonfiction
- Content Writer: Responsible for creating engaging and informative content across various platforms, highly sought after due to the growing demand for digital content.
- Editor: Plays a crucial role in refining written works, ensuring clarity and coherence, with a strong focus on quality control in publications.
- Copywriter: Specializes in crafting persuasive text for advertisements and marketing materials, vital for brand storytelling and customer engagement.
- Creative Nonfiction Author: Focuses on writing narrative-driven nonfiction that captivates readers, an expanding field as audiences seek authentic storytelling.
- Literary Agent: Represents authors and works to sell manuscripts to publishers, integral to the publishing process and author success.
- Publishing Professional: Involves various roles in the publishing industry, from marketing to production, essential for bringing books to market.
